The Chinese Furniture Cultural Association: Preserving and Promoting Chinese Furniture Heritage79


The Chinese Furniture Cultural Association (CFCA) is a non-profit organization dedicated to the preservation, research, and promotion of Chinese furniture culture. Founded in 2008, the association aims to bring together furniture professionals, scholars, collectors, and enthusiasts from around the world to exchange knowledge, foster collaborations, and elevate the appreciation of Chinese furniture as an integral part of Chinese cultural heritage.

Mission and Objectives

The CFCA's mission is threefold:
Preservation: To safeguard and protect Chinese furniture heritage by documenting, conserving, and restoring historical pieces.
Research: To conduct in-depth studies on Chinese furniture history, styles, techniques, and cultural significance.
Promotion: To promote the appreciation and understanding of Chinese furniture through exhibitions, publications, and educational programs.

Activities and Initiatives

The CFCA carries out its mission through a wide range of activities and initiatives, including:
Conferences and Symposia: The association hosts regular conferences and symposia where scholars, experts, and collectors present their research findings and engage in discussions on Chinese furniture.
Exhibitions and Exhibitions: The CFCA organizes and supports exhibitions showcasing historical and contemporary Chinese furniture, providing a platform for public engagement and appreciation.
Publications: The association publishes a quarterly journal and other reference materials on Chinese furniture, providing valuable resources for researchers and enthusiasts alike.
Educational Programs: The CFCA offers workshops, lectures, and study tours to educate the public about Chinese furniture, including its history, craftsmanship, and cultural significance.
International Collaborations: The association fosters partnerships with institutions and organizations worldwide to promote the exchange of knowledge and preservation efforts.

Membership and Governance

Membership in the CFCA is open to individuals and organizations with an interest in Chinese furniture. The association is governed by an elected board of directors, which comprises furniture experts, collectors, and academics. The board is responsible for overseeing the CFCA's strategic direction and day-to-day operations.
